Building Systems: What Buyers Should Check

A property can look clean, bright, and well maintained on the surface while its building systems tell a very different story. For buyers and owners in Portugal, that gap matters. Electrical, plumbing, drainage, roofing ventilation, insulation, and hot water systems often determine whether a home is a sound asset or an expensive problem waiting for the first heavy rain, heat wave, or contractor quote.

When people think about property risk, they usually focus on structure first, and that is reasonable. But in practice, many of the budget shocks come from systems hidden behind walls, above ceilings, under floors, and on roofs. These are the working parts of the building. If they are outdated, poorly installed, undersized, or incompatible with planned renovation work, the cost and disruption can escalate quickly.

Why building systems matter before you buy

A buyer viewing a house or apartment is often shown finishes, room sizes, natural light, and exterior charm. Those things affect livability and resale appeal, but they do not tell you enough about how the property performs. Building systems affect safety, reliability, running costs, maintenance burden, and renovation feasibility.

An older electrical installation may still function, but that does not mean it meets current demands. A plumbing system may deliver water at the tap, yet still conceal pressure issues, corrosion, poor routing, or drainage weaknesses. A roof may look acceptable from ground level while trapped moisture, failed flashings, or poor rainwater management are already damaging the envelope below.

This is where many buyers make costly assumptions. If a property is occupied, they assume the systems are adequate. If it was recently painted, they assume damp issues were resolved. If the kitchen and bathrooms look updated, they assume the technical work behind the finishes was carried out properly. Those assumptions are exactly where risk grows.

Building systems are not all equal in old and renovated properties

In Portugal, building age matters, but renovation history matters just as much. A century-old property that has been carefully upgraded can be lower risk than a 1990s apartment with neglected maintenance and piecemeal repairs. The issue is not simply old versus new. It is whether systems were designed, installed, and adapted with logic.

In many residential properties, changes happen in stages. A water heater is replaced without reviewing pipe condition. Air conditioning is added without checking electrical capacity. Bathrooms are renovated cosmetically while drainage slopes remain poor. Roof repairs address a visible leak but not the path water is taking through the assembly. Each isolated fix may appear reasonable, but together they can create a building that works only until the next stress point.

For international buyers, this can be harder to read. Construction methods, repair standards, and service expectations may differ from what they know at home. A system that appears acceptable during a short viewing may not align with their plans for year-round occupancy, rental use, or a major remodel.

What to assess in a property’s core systems

The right level of assessment depends on the property type, age, and intended use, but several areas nearly always deserve attention.

Electrical systems

Electrical risk is not just about obvious hazards. It is also about capacity, layout, and future suitability. A buyer planning to install heating, cooling, induction cooking, or an electric vehicle charger needs to know whether the existing setup can support those loads. If not, the upgrade may involve more than a new panel. It can affect routing, finishes, contractor scope, and utility coordination.

Signs of concern include inconsistent alterations, aging components, missing protection, exposed temporary-looking fixes, and evidence that additions were made without a wider plan. Even when the system is technically operational, it may be inefficient or restrictive for modern living.

Plumbing and drainage

Water problems are expensive because they can damage finishes, weaken materials, and remain hidden for long periods. Plumbing should be considered in terms of supply, waste, pressure, condition, and layout. A property may have recurring maintenance issues not because of one failed component, but because the system as a whole was poorly thought through.

Drainage deserves particular attention. Slow discharge, bad odors, staining, past patch repairs, or signs of repeated bathroom and kitchen intervention can indicate deeper problems. In renovation projects, drainage routes can also limit what is realistically possible when reconfiguring rooms.

Roof, rainwater, and moisture management

Many buyers underestimate how strongly roof condition connects to interior risk. Water ingress does not always show itself where it enters. By the time staining appears inside, insulation, timber, plaster, or adjacent systems may already be affected.

Roof coverings, flashings, drainage points, slopes, penetrations, and transitions all matter. So does access. If a roof cannot be inspected properly, uncertainty remains high. This is why drone review and targeted inspection can be so valuable. You need evidence, not guesses from ground level.

Moisture should also be understood in context. Condensation, rising damp, roof leaks, and facade penetration can produce similar visual symptoms but require very different solutions. Painting over the symptom is common. Solving the mechanism is less common.

Heating, cooling, and hot water

Comfort systems are often treated as a lifestyle question, but they are also a financial one. Buyers should ask whether the property can maintain reasonable comfort through summer and winter without wasteful operating costs. That depends on equipment, controls, insulation, air leakage, and how the building actually behaves.

A new hot water cylinder or a modern split unit does not automatically mean the wider system is sound. Equipment may be oversized, poorly located, insufficiently maintained, or installed as a workaround for deeper envelope issues. If your plan includes full-time living or rental performance, this matters early.

The real issue is integration

The biggest mistakes happen when building systems are reviewed one by one without considering how they interact. A property is a set of connected conditions. Improve insulation and you may need to think differently about ventilation. Reconfigure bathrooms and the drainage strategy may change. Add roof-mounted equipment and access, waterproofing, and electrical routes all come into play.

This is why pre-purchase analysis is so valuable. It moves the conversation away from isolated defects and toward decision quality. You are not just asking, “Does this item work today?” You are asking, “What does this mean for ownership, renovation sequencing, future cost, and risk?”

That distinction matters because many system issues are manageable when they are identified early. They become expensive when they are discovered halfway through works, after budgets are set and finishes are already being opened up.

How smart buyers approach system risk

The best approach is structured. First, analyze the current condition using direct observation and, where useful, technical tools such as roof imaging, measured survey data, or targeted moisture assessment. Then understand what the findings mean in practical terms. Not every defect is urgent, and not every old system requires immediate replacement. The goal is to separate cosmetic noise from technical reality.

Next, plan around the property you actually have, not the one you hoped the viewing suggested. That means aligning renovation ambition with system capacity, access constraints, likely hidden works, and maintenance priorities. Only then should execution decisions follow.

When to investigate further

Some scenarios justify deeper scrutiny before purchase or before committing to renovation. One is a property that has been superficially refreshed for sale. Another is any building with a mix of old fabric and recent upgrades. A third is an asset intended for major change in use, such as converting a seasonal home into a full-time residence or repositioning a dated unit as a higher-value rental.

It also makes sense to investigate further when the property is hard to access visually, when records are limited, or when defects have likely been concealed rather than resolved. None of this means the property is a bad purchase. It means the decision should be made with clear eyes.

A good property decision is rarely about finding a perfect building. It is about understanding the building systems well enough to price risk, plan work realistically, and avoid being surprised by problems that were visible to anyone who knew where to look.

If you are buying or renovating in Portugal, the safest position is simple: trust the evidence, not the finish quality.
